61600023 has 6 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 88977824. Its totient is φ = 41066676.

The previous prime is 61600009. The next prime is 61600039. The reversal of 61600023 is 32000616.

It is a happy number.

61600023 is a `hidden beast` number, since 61 + 600 + 0 + 2 + 3 = 666.

It is not a de Polignac number, because 61600023 - 25 = 61599991 is a prime.

It is a Duffinian number.

It is a junction number, because it is equal to n+sod(n) for n = 61599969 and 61600005.

It is a congruent number.

It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(61607023) by changing a digit.

It is a polite number, since it can be written in 5 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 3422215 + ... + 3422232.

Almost surely, 261600023 is an apocalyptic number.

61600023 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(27377801).

61600023 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.

61600023 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.

The sum of its prime factors is 6844453 (or 6844450 counting only the distinct ones).

The product of its (nonzero) digits is 216, while the sum is 18.

The square root of 61600023 is about 7848.5682133750. The cubic root of 61600023 is about 394.9362135958.

Adding to 61600023 its reverse (32000616), we get a palindrome (93600639).

The spelling of 61600023 in words is "sixty-one million, six hundred thousand, twenty-three".

Divisors: 1 3 9 6844447 20533341 61600023
